There are sixteen sets of medals to be awarded during the triple European Championships in Herning next week. The official name is ECCO FEI European Championships where a string of equestrian sport stars, riders and horses, will go into tight battle for the medals.
Normally the expensive legs of footballers roam around on the grass at the MCH Arena, the MCH Messecenter Herning football stadium. From the 20 to the 25 of August there will be horse legs cantering around on a 15 cm thick layer of a special sand mixture – all battling for honour, glory and medals together with their riders. Because the stage is set for a magnificent European Championship in three equestrian disciplines: jumping, dressage and para-dressage. The countdown is on, the gates of the great exhibition area in front of MCH arena in Herning opens on Tuesday 20 of August at 16:00. As a sign of good will the organisers European–Herning keep the exhibition area open for free, no admission at all on opening day for Danish and foreign horse lovers. It will give the already smitten and passionate equestrian enthusiasts and those yet to be convinced a possibility to get a feel for the ambience and see the impressive structures in place all around the event area.
The preparations have entered their final phase
Until now the pre-work has been of an administrative type but now the mere physical frames of the event are being put into place at the MCH Messecenter Herning’s huge parking lot in front of MCH Arena and Boxen.
In this area busy hands are fully occupied with raising the 2,400 m2 huge food and party tent which is located in between the warm-up area and JYSK Arena – and it is 120 m long.
Large heaps of sand and rubber mats lie in specific spots in the area ready to be transformed into warm-up arenas and competition courses. It is Neergaard Stald Design by Allan and Bent Neergaard, who has the responsibility for the establishment and maintenance of the all in all 23,000 m2 footing that will be prepared in and around the arenas at MCH Messecenter Herning.
The competition course MCH arena in itself will be covered with 8,000 rubber mats as a ground for 1,300 m3 of sand mixture.
Entertainment, food and beverages and loads of shopping
The exhibition area is under its final construction and ready for the many companies with stands from Denmark and abroad. The smallest stands will be about 36 m2 so you can easily exercise your shopping genes during the European Championships. You can see the list of stands here.
In the exhibition area where the many stands are located there will be a food court where you can satisfy any cravings for food and drinks. There will be many different food stands offering a large variety of Danish specialities but also an international cuisine with for example Mexican and Italian food among other assorted cuisines. In addition there will be a large gastronomy tent, managed by MCH Messecenter Herning with a broad choice from the Danish and international cuisine.
450 volunteers
Over the last three years the organisers and an enthusiastic staff of volunteers have worked hard to make the Championships in Herning a good and memorable experience for all participants. During the actual championships around 450 volunteers will work on site and fill various functions throughout the competition and exhibition area.
The many volunteers are lead by appointed area managers who have met several times in the last year to cooperate and coordinate their efforts before and during the championships. During the event all volunteers will wear identical clothing to make everyone easily identified among the many visitors.
